How AI Shopping Carts Work
The technology behind these smart shopping carts utilizes algorithms that analyze data points such as shopping habits, dietary preferences, and user reviews. Here's a breakdown of how this system operates:
- Data Analysis: The AI continuously learns from user interactions, adapting its recommendations to improve accuracy over time.
- User Profiles: It creates personalized profiles that record purchase history and preferences, making suggestions more relevant.
- Real-Time Suggestions: As users add items to their carts, the AI can recommend complementary products or alternatives, optimizing shopping efficiency.

Potential Challenges and Considerations
While the benefits are compelling, there are challenges that Instacart and similar companies must navigate:
- Privacy Concerns: As AI relies heavily on user data, consumers may be wary about how their information is collected and used.
- Algorithmic Bias: Relying on algorithms raises questions about fairness, especially if the data reflects biases that perpetuate inequalities.
- Implementation Cost: Developing and maintaining this technology comes with a significant financial investment, which may deter smaller retailers from adopting similar systems.
